Esikhathini esinezikhuphu eziphakemeyo zomkhakha wamafutha negesi, lapho imisebenzi isebenza khona ubusuku bonke, ukuthembeka kwezinhlelo zokuhlinzekwa kwamandla akuyona nje imfuneko kodwa kube nesidingo esibucayi. Izixazululo zebhethri ezisekelayo zidlala indima ebaluleke kakhulu ekuqinisekiseni ukusebenza okungaphazamiseki kulo mkhakha.
Umkhakha we-oyili negesi unzima ngokwemvelo. Lokhu kufakwa kuncike kakhulu ekunikezelweni kwamandla okungaguquki ukuze kugcinwe ubuqotho bokusebenza, ukuphatha ukuqoqwa kwedatha, izinqubo zokulawula, kanye nokuqinisekisa ukuphepha kwabasebenzi. Ukuphazamiseka ekunikezelweni kwamandla kungaholela ekuphazamisweni okubalulekile kokusebenza noma ukwehluleka okuyinhlekelele, okwenza ama-robust backup systems asemqoka. Amabhethri e-Backup akhonza njengokwehluleka okuphephile ekuphazanyisweni okunjalo, anikeze amandla abucayi ngesikhathi sokuphuma kuze kube yilapho amasistimu aphambili abuyiselwe noma aze afike eminye imithombo eza online.
Ngale ndawo efunwayo, kuqashwa izinhlobo eziningi zamabhethri e-backup. Okuvame kakhulu kufaka phakathi:
Amabhethri we-Valve alawulwa i-lead-acid (VRLA): ngokwesiko ethandwa ngempumelelo nokuthembela kwawo. Ziyakwazi ukulungiswa futhi zinempilo yebhethri ende, futhi zingasetshenziswa embonini kawoyela negesi ukuze zisebenze kwezinye izindawo eziyinselele kakhulu emhlabeni, ezinjengesimo sezulu esibi kakhulu, izimo ezinzima kanye namazinga okushisa aphezulu.
Amabhethri we-Nickel-Cadmium (NI-CD): Amabhethri we-NI-CD awadingi ukwengezwa kwamanzi kuyo yonke impilo yakhe. Okuphansi noma akukho ukulungiswa, noma kusebenza ezindaweni ezinokhahlo njengemboni kawoyela negesi, nasezindaweni ezikude lapho ingqalasizinda iyashoda khona.
